Amyl and The Sniffers have already had a monster year, destroying the main stages of European summer festivals, supporting Foo Fighters on their recent US stadium run, and selling out their own headline tours in the US, UK and Europe, including three consecutive nights at the 3,000-capacity Roundhouse in London. They are the main support for Fontaines DC's 45,000 capacity Finsbury Park show in July 2025 (already sold out) and have just announced their biggest headline ever at London's Alexandra Palace.

Following the release of singles U Should Not Be Doing That, Chewing Gum, Big Dreams and the joyful FU that is Jerkin', Amyl and The Sniffers are entering a new era with their third album, Cartoon Darkness. Already hailed as "album of the year" (Clash) and "a level-up in every way" (Brooklyn Vegan), Cartoon Darkness sees the Sniffers grow in brilliant, bold directions -- still delivering hard and fast thrills, but expanding the heart, the danceable hooks, and the humor, channeling Amy Taylor's singular worldview into the Sniffers' most mature and exciting album to date.
